没有合适的资源?快使用搜索试试~ 我知道了~
A12_类SRAM接口说明1
需积分: 0 1 下载量 29 浏览量
2022-08-03
23:20:29
上传
评论
收藏 448KB PDF 举报
温馨提示
试读
4页
1. addr[1:0]=2’b00 时,可能的组合: 2. addr[1:0]=2’b01 时,可能的组合: 3. addr[1:0]=2’b10 时,可能的
资源详情
资源评论
资源推荐
1
1 类 SRAM 接口说明
大赛要求 myCPU 封装为 AXI 接口,具体实现有以下两种方法:
(1) 自定义内部取指、访存与 AXI 接口的交互信号,然后封装为 AXI 接口。
(2) 自定义内部取指、访存与其他接口的交互辛哈,再使用转换桥转换为 AXI 接口。比如内部实现为类
SRAM 接口,使用官方提供的类 SRAM 转 AXI 的桥来转接。
我们推荐方法一,这样可以自己对接口进行设计,以提升访存性能。大赛提供的类 SRAM 转 AXI 的桥代码参
考本目录下的 cpu_axi_interface.v,效率偏低,且不支持 burst 传输。
在 SoC_SRAM_Lite 中,myCPU 接口是 SRAM 接口,数据访问都是单周期返回的。接口简单,却也限制了
myCPU 的频率。myCPU 频率不能超过 RAM 的读写频率。
实际 CPU 频率是普遍高与存储器读写频率的,所以很多时候访问都是需要多个 CPU 周期才能返回的。为此为
SRAM 接口增加地址传输握手信号 addr_ok 和数据传输握手信号 data_ok,这样就可以实现任意周期返回数据了,
称为类 SRAM 接口。下表展示了类 SRAM 的接口信号,与 2017 年大赛提供的类 SRAM 接口定义稍有不同。
表 1-1 类 SRAM 接口信号
信号
位宽
方向
功能
clk
1
input
时钟
req
1
master—>slave
请求信号,为 1 时有读写请求,为 0 时无读写请求
wr
1
master—>slave
该次请求是写
size
[1:0]
master—>slave
该次请求传输的字节数,0: 1byte;1: 2bytes;2: 4bytes。
addr
[31:0]
master—>slave
该次请求的地址
wdata
[31:0]
master—>slave
该次请求的写数据
addr_ok
1
slave—>master
该次请求的地址传输 OK,读:地址被接收;写:地址和数据被接
收
data_ok
1
slave—>master
该次请求的数据传输 OK,读:数据返回;写:数据写入完成。
rdata
[31:0]
slave—>master
该次请求返回的读数据。
需要注意,不同于 SRAM 接口,类 SRAM 的地址信号(addr)是字节寻址的,其指向读写数据的
最低有效位。因而 addr 和 size 信号需配合使用,不支持 3 字节读写,有且只有以下类型组合。
1. addr[1:0]=2’b00 时,可能的组合:
size=2’b00, size=2’b01, size=4’b10,
2. addr[1:0]=2’b01 时,可能的组合:
size=2’b00
3. addr[1:0]=2’b10 时,可能的组合:
size=2’b00, size=2’b01
4. addr[1:0]=2’b11 时,可能的组合:
size=2’b00
wdata 和 rdata 有效数据字节也与 size 与 addr[1:0]信号对应,小尾端下,配合如下:
田仲政
- 粉丝: 15
- 资源: 332
上传资源 快速赚钱
- 我的内容管理 展开
- 我的资源 快来上传第一个资源
- 我的收益 登录查看自己的收益
- 我的积分 登录查看自己的积分
- 我的C币 登录后查看C币余额
- 我的收藏
- 我的下载
- 下载帮助
最新资源
- 实验二:IP协议分析.zip
- 驱动代码驱动代码驱动代码驱动代码
- SVID_20240523_141155_1.mp4
- Code for the complete guide to tkinter tutorial
- 关于百货中心供应链管理系统.zip
- SimpleFolderIcon-master 修改Unity的Project下的文件夹图标
- A python Tkinter widget to display tile based maps
- A pure Python library for adding tables to a Tkinter application
- Vector资源文件.zip
- MobaXterm-Installer
资源上传下载、课程学习等过程中有任何疑问或建议,欢迎提出宝贵意见哦~我们会及时处理!
点击此处反馈
安全验证
文档复制为VIP权益,开通VIP直接复制
信息提交成功
评论0